The Solid White editorial campaign for Helmut Lang, featured in the June 2002 issue of Mr. High Fashion (MHF) Magazine, stands as a quintessential exploration of Lang's minimalist ethos. Shot in stark, high-contrast monochrome, the campaign juxtaposes clinical precision with an almost surreal detachment. The editorial's title, Solid White, aptly reflects Lang's signature aesthetic: a study in architectural tailoring, sterile textures, and the purity of unembellished form. The collection itself was composed of structured suiting, industrial fabrics, and technical detailing—hallmarks of Lang's ability to blur the line between utilitarian and avant-garde. Models, stripped of unnecessary adornments, were framed against austere, modular backdrops, reinforcing the designer's fascination with space as an extension of the body.
